Transaction 308476103ed6ef1f95327227977cc3522d0e8072f5c5cd6d6b9c2f17283edfe8
1 Input
1 Output
-
308476103ed6ef1f95327227977cc3522d0e8072f5c5cd6d6b9c2f17283edfe8:0
- value
- 2515241
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 38f44e2edac03803f889a941b3c48ad818df8127 OP_EQUAL
- address
- MD6JjoussHA84jGa37gx8iui3FmHrEtR83